# Zola ʕ•ᴥ•ʔ Bear Blog [![Netlify Status](https://api.netlify.com/api/v1/badges/121b53ce-c913-4604-9179-eb3cca31cd2c/deploy-status)](https://app.netlify.com/sites/zola-bearblog/deploys) 🧸 A [Zola](https://www.getzola.org/)-theme based on [Bear Blog](https://bearblog.dev). > Free, no-nonsense, super-fast blogging. ## Demo For a current & working demo of this theme, please check out 🎯. ## Screenshots ⬜️ [Light][light-screenshot] ![light mode screenshot][light-screenshot] ⬛️ [Dark][dark-screenshot] ![dark mode screenshot][dark-screenshot] When the user's browser is running »dark mode«, the dark color scheme will be used automatically. The default is the light/white color scheme. Check out the [`style.html`](https://codeberg.org/alanpearce/zola-bearblog/src/branch/main/templates/style.html)-file for the implementation. ## Installation If you already have a Zola site on your machine, you can simply add this theme via ``` git submodule add https://codeberg.org/alanpearce/zola-bearblog themes/zola-bearblog ``` Then, adjust the `config.toml` as detailed below. For more information, read the official [setup guide][zola-setup-guide] of Zola. ## Adjust configuration / config.toml Please check out the included [config.toml](https://codeberg.org/alanpearce/zola-bearblog/src/branch/main/config.toml) ## Content & structure ### Menu Create an array in `extra` with a key of `main_menu`. `url` is passed to [`get_url`](https://www.getzola.org/documentation/templates/overview/#get-url) ```toml [[extra.main_menu]] name = "Bear" url = "@/bear.md" [[extra.main_menu]] name = "Zola" url = "@/zola.md" [[extra.main_menu]] name = "Blog" url = "@/blog/_index.md" ``` ### Adding / editing content #### Index-Page The contents of the `index`-page may be changed by editing your `content/_index.md`-file. ### Adding your branding / colors / css Add a `custom_head.html`-file to your `templates/`-directory.
